HVAC/R Commissioning Technician – Naval (Basildon, UK)
Join Johnson Controls Marine & Navy HVAC & Refrigeration team in Basildon, Essex, where we build and commission high-quality HVAC/R systems for naval vessels. If you have a solid background in refrigeration or HVAC and enjoy hands‑on technical work, this is a great opportunity to apply your skills in a unique environment. You’ll work with well-supported processes, modern equipment, and a friendly team who will help you grow into the naval side of the industry.
Aboutthe Role
We are looking for an experienced HVAC/R Commissioning Technician to commission naval HVAC and refrigeration units, ensuring they meet strict performance, safety, and regulatory standards. This hands‑on role is primarily based in our Basildon test facility, with travel to UK naval sites and occasional international assignments.
Responsibilities- Commission ATUs and associated HVAC systems in the test bay and on customer sites.
- Perform electrical and mechanical hookup, calibration, and functional testing.
- Carry out Factory Acceptance Testing (FAT) and support integration activities.
- Ensure full compliance with F‑Gas regulations, including leak checks, recovery, and documentation.
- Diagnose and resolve commissioning issues, providing feedback to engineering teams.
- Produce accurate test reports and handover documentation.
- Maintain and calibrate test equipment, ensuring safety and quality standards are upheld.
- Travel for site work and customer support, including occasional overnight stays.
